			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-76" title="Pacific Coast View" src="http://msrazvi.files.wordpress.com/2009/08/pacific-coast-view.jpg?w=477" alt="Pacific Coast View"   /></p>
<p>A visit to California wouldn&#8217;t be complete without a coastal ride.  From San Francisco, I made my way down Highway 1 back towards Santa Barbara (where I began my three week adventure).  I was a little scared beginning this journey because I heard that a few days before a driver had just driven over the cliffs.  I guess he walked away from the accident just fine (not the car though) but I didn&#8217;t want any mistakes like that!  The ride was great because the ocean water was bright blue in some places, rocks jutted out of the waters, surfers enjoyed the waves, and the cliffs dropped dramatically.</p>
<p>At one point I noticed that several people had stopped and were looking at some animal on the beach.  I decided to pull over and glance myself, especially since the people seemed to be so lose to the animals.  When I got closer, I noticed they were seals.  But not just any seals, most of them were elephant seals.  They are very large and they have long noses the sort of curve under (like the top of an elephant&#8217;s nose).  I spent quite a bit of time just looking at these creatures sunbathe.  They seem to be so lazy too.  Some would get the urge to move and sort of flop towards the water for two seconds and then just flop down as though they were tired from exerting so much energy.  Another funny thing they would do is throw sand on themselves.  They use the sand to cover their bodies and protect their skin from the sun.  I saw some fighting (which I read is common), some swimming, and some just rolling over.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-70" title="Cali trip 037" src="http://msrazvi.files.wordpress.com/2009/08/cali-trip-037.jpg?w=300&#038;h=225" alt="Cali trip 037" width="300" height="225" /></p>
<p>Lassen Volcanic National Park was lots of fun, but it was time to head back near the coast.  The next stop was San Francisco.  Upon arriving in the city I had to go over the famous Golden Gate Bridge, which is a symbol for the city.  I pulled over into a parking lot before driving over so I could walk on the bridge.  Unfortunately, summer is not the best season to see San Francisco.  It stays nearly covered in fog and the sun just doesn&#8217;t show through.  I was lucky to see as much of the bridge as I did because the clouds covered only the top of it.</p>
<p>The first day in the city I did some of the more tourist type things.  I walked around the hilly streets (and boy were there some steep climbs), ate dinner on Fisherman&#8217;s Wharf, and rode the cable car back up the hill in the evening.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m not a huge fan of cities because I don&#8217;t like how they are crowded with people, cars, and too much activity.  So the second day I tried to stay away from the crowds and find quieter places.  One place I enjoyed was the Golden Gate Park.  It is kind of like New York City&#8217;s Central Park &#8211; a large green space with gardens, fields, and walking trails.  In the park I found the Japanese Tea Garden where I had tea and cookies.  It was a struggle to keep the birds away from the food!  Since the city on the ocean, I found my way to the beach.  Of course, it wasn&#8217;t a beach day because of the fog and oh yeah&#8230;it was cold!  I had to wear a sweatshirt the entire time in the city because it was so chilly.  Anyway, I took a nice walk on the beach and watched the surfers.  I ate lunch at a place called the Cliff House, which has an interesting history.  There have been three Cliff Houses because the previous ones all burned down.  It used to be a fun hang out because they had something called the Sutro Baths.  They were 6 large swimming pools with most of them filled with salt water.  In 1966 they burned and were never replaced.  You can still see the ruins of the baths from the Cliff House.</p>
<p>That evening, I had dinner in Chinatown.  Most major cities have a Chinatown and San Francisco&#8217;s Chinatown is the oldest in the country.  Going to San Francisco was a nice change of pace from the remote mountains I had been exploring.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Leaving Lake Tahoe, I headed further Northwest to Lassen Volcanic National Park.  I had read before going that it is a park that is not regularly visited so I knew it would not be crowded.  And it wasn&#8217;t even though that weekend there was free admission.  I love a good deal!  Lassen is unique because in a small area (which really isn&#8217;t that small) there are all four types of volcanoes.  The last major eruption of Lassen Volcano was in 1915.  Climbing Lassen Peak is one of the most popular hikes in the park, but it was mostly closed due to a rock slide.  There were also several other trails closed because of fires in the park.  I could see the smoke towards the end of the park as I drove through.</p>
<p>My greatest adventure in Lassen was going to a place called Bumpass Hell.  Here you can see boiling waters, gurgling mud pots, and steam vents that hiss.  I have some interesting video showing all of that, but I&#8217;m not sure how to put it in my blog yet.  Stay tuned for videos!  Anyway, you  walk out on a platform that brings you as close as you can get to seeing steam and the bubbling mud.  You are not allowed to walk on the ground because you could fall through and burn yourself badly.  The one thing you have to deal with is the smell!  There is a pretty bad sulfur smell (like rotten eggs).  I heard a lot of the children complaining about it, but I didn&#8217;t think it was too awful.  The awesome sites kept my mind away from the odor.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I stayed in an area West of Lake Tahoe near Donner Summit (Soda Springs).  The area is also known for hosting the 1960 winter Olympics.  Many people flock to this area in the winter time for great skiing (I&#8217;m not a skier) and in the warmer months people hike, bike, and enjoy the mountain lakes.</p>
<p>I spent one day exploring the mountains and climbing Mt. Judah.  I enjoy hiking sometimes (I have to be in the mood), but I really enjoyed this hike.  It was pretty easy going and I never felt like I was going straight uphill.  It was a gradual climb that zigzagged.  There were some parts that were very rocky, but I enjoyed the challenge of dodging loose rocks and quickly but carefully planting your feet hoping not to fall.  Once getting to the top I actually found snow!  Can you believe I came to California and found snow?  The picture is of me throwing a snowball.  If you want to check out a trail map go to:<a href="http://www.fs.fed.us/r5/tahoe/documents/rec/mtjudahloop.pdf"> http://www.fs.fed.us/r5/tahoe/documents/rec/mtjudahloop.pdf </a>(I did the Mt. Judah loop).</p>
<p><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-43" title="Cali trip 010" src="http://msrazvi.files.wordpress.com/2009/08/cali-trip-010.jpg?w=300&#038;h=225" alt="Cali trip 010" width="300" height="225" /></p>
<p>The second day I went out on a canoe on a lake close to where I was staying.  It was a small shallow lake.  It is always fun to be out on the water!  I spent the rest of the day relaxing on a rocky beach at Lake Tahoe.  This lake is very large, deep, and contains 30 trillion gallons of water (that&#8217;s a lot!).  It is also very clear and the water is a brilliant blue-green color.  I was hoping to see a nice sunset in the evening, but I never got to.</p>
<p>On this trip I became interested in learning more about the tragedy of the Donner Party who made their way to California in 1846-1847.  I find that as I travel to places I get very interested in the history of the area and the people that are important to that area.  Normally I would not pick up a book about the Donner party, but being in the place where they actually struggled made me want to know more about them and that part of history.  So f or my adult audience, if you think you might be interested in knowing more (although I have to say that experiencing the land gives a totally different perspective on what happened) I suggest reading Ordeal by Hunger by George Stewart.</p>
